Skip to content
This repository has been archived by the owner on Jun 7, 2020. It is now read-only.

SSO broken when using border proxy #2823

Open
apereira-dcca opened this issue Apr 10, 2020 · 0 comments
Open

SSO broken when using border proxy #2823

apereira-dcca opened this issue Apr 10, 2020 · 0 comments

Comments

@apereira-dcca
Copy link

  • Your Rocket.Chat app version: 4.6.3.294
  • Your Rocket.Chat server version: 3.0.12
  • Device (or Simulator) you're running with: iPhone XR

I have set up RocketChat on an internal server, and I am planning to make it available to my users when off-site using Microsoft's Web App Proxy. Currently, this configuration is working for all web browsers I have tested (Firefox, Chrome, Safari on iOS, Firefox on Android). However, the iOS and Android apps will not complete authentication when outside my network.
In both iOS and Android apps, when connecting via the Web App Proxy (which is configured for pass through of all traffic, it's meant to be transparent), I am able to connect to my server, click the button for SAML authentication, and then I am redirected to my IDP (ADFS 4.0). I successfully authenticate, and I am redirected to RocketChat. Then, after a few seconds, the page that opened for SSO auth closes, and I'm back at the "Company Login" button.
Authentication works normally within the network, but my users are not permitted to connect their phones to the corporate network. Is there a way to fix or work-around this log-in bug?

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
None yet
Projects
None yet
Development

No branches or pull requests

1 participant